About Fluree AI
Fluree AI is an AI coding agent platform built to give every AI agent trusted context as it operates on coding tasks.
Its defining focus is providing trusted context for AI agents, reflecting the product's core positioning around reliable grounding for agent work and consistent, accurate decision-making.
It is aimed at developers and engineering teams building or deploying AI coding agents who need consistent, trustworthy contextual information to support their agents' day-to-day operations and outputs.
It sits within the category of AI coding agent tools that prioritize context trust as a central feature, alongside peers focused on coding automation and agent reliability.

- What Is an AI Agent Harness? The Runtime That Turns an LLM Into an Agent
A harness is the runtime wrapper that turns a bare language model into an agent — the layer that runs tools, holds memory, assembles context, and enforces limits. The model does the reasoning; the harness does everything the model can't do on its own. It's the part that decides whether you shipped a chatbot or a real agent — and it's why the same model feels brilliant in one tool and useless in another.

Claude Code has built-in memory — a CLAUDE.md file it reads each session — but it only holds short, hand-written notes. To make it understand a large codebase or docs set, you add a second brain: turn the repo into a knowledge graph, fold that into an Obsidian vault, and let the agent query the map instead of re-reading every file.
